There lies a paradox in sleep. Its obvious tranquility juxtaposes with the mind’s bustling exercise. The evening continues to be, however the mind is much from dormant. Throughout sleep, mind cells produce bursts {of electrical} pulses that cumulate into rhythmic waves — an indication of heightened mind cell operate.

However why is the mind energetic after we are resting?

Sluggish mind waves are related to restful, refreshing sleep. And now, scientists at Washington College Faculty of Drugs in St. Louis have discovered that mind waves assist flush waste out of the mind throughout sleep. Particular person nerve cells coordinate to supply rhythmic waves that propel fluid via dense mind tissue, washing the tissue within the course of.

“These neurons are miniature pumps. Synchronized neural exercise powers fluid circulation and elimination of particles from the mind,” defined first writer Li-Feng Jiang-Xie, PhD, a postdoctoral analysis affiliate within the Division of Pathology & Immunology. “If we are able to construct on this course of, there’s the potential of delaying and even stopping neurological ailments, together with Alzheimer’s and Parkinson’s illness, wherein extra waste — resembling metabolic waste and junk proteins — accumulate within the mind and result in neurodegeneration.”

The findings are printed Feb. 28 in Nature.

Mind cells orchestrate ideas, emotions and physique actions, and kind dynamic networks important for reminiscence formation and problem-solving. However to carry out such energy-demanding duties, mind cells require gas. Their consumption of vitamins from the food regimen creates metabolic waste within the course of.

“It’s vital that the mind disposes of metabolic waste that may construct up and contribute to neurodegenerative ailments,” mentioned Jonathan Kipnis, PhD, the Alan A. and Edith L. Wolff Distinguished Professor of Pathology & Immunology and a BJC Investigator. Kipnis is the senior writer on the paper. “We knew that sleep is a time when the mind initiates a cleansing course of to flush out waste and toxins it accumulates throughout wakefulness. However we did not know the way that occurs. These findings may have the ability to level us towards methods and potential therapies to hurry up the elimination of damaging waste and to take away it earlier than it may result in dire penalties.”

However cleansing the dense mind isn’t any easy job. Cerebrospinal fluid surrounding the mind enters and weaves via intricate mobile webs, gathering poisonous waste because it travels. Upon exiting the mind, contaminated fluid should cross via a barrier earlier than spilling into the lymphatic vessels within the dura mater — the outer tissue layer enveloping the mind beneath the cranium. However what powers the motion of fluid into, via and out of the mind?

Learning the brains of sleeping mice, the researchers discovered that neurons drive cleansing efforts by firing electrical indicators in a coordinated vogue to generate rhythmic waves within the mind, Jiang-Xie defined. They decided that such waves propel the fluid motion.

The analysis crew silenced particular mind areas in order that neurons in these areas did not create rhythmic waves. With out these waves, recent cerebrospinal fluid couldn’t circulation via the silenced mind areas and trapped waste could not depart the mind tissue.

“One of many causes that we sleep is to cleanse the mind,” Kipnis mentioned. “And if we are able to improve this cleaning course of, maybe it is potential to sleep much less and stay wholesome. Not everybody has the advantage of eight hours of sleep every evening, and lack of sleep has an influence on well being. Different research have proven that mice which can be genetically wired to sleep much less have wholesome brains. May or not it’s as a result of they clear waste from their brains extra effectively? May we assist folks residing with insomnia by enhancing their mind’s cleansing talents to allow them to get by on much less sleep?”

Mind wave patterns change all through sleep cycles. Of observe, taller mind waves with bigger amplitude transfer fluid with extra drive. The researchers are actually involved in understanding why neurons hearth waves with various rhythmicity throughout sleep and which areas of the mind are most weak to waste accumulation.

“We expect the brain-cleaning course of is much like washing dishes,” neurobiologist Jiang-Xie defined. “You begin, for instance, with a big, sluggish, rhythmic wiping movement to wash soluble wastes splattered throughout the plate. You then lower the vary of the movement and enhance the pace of those actions to take away notably sticky meals waste on the plate. Regardless of the various amplitude and rhythm of your hand actions, the overarching goal stays constant: to take away several types of waste from dishes. Possibly the mind adjusts its cleansing methodology relying on the kind and quantity of waste.”
